Photograph Information Photographer's Comments
Challenge: Black & White II (Basic Editing I)
Camera: Canon EOS-300D Rebel
Location: our kitchen in Hong Kong
Date: Nov 16, 2004
Aperture: 2.8
ISO: 100
Shutter: 1/60
Galleries: Family, Black and White
Date Uploaded: Nov 16, 2004

I couldn't make the milk heat up any faster, so I decided I might as well catch the moment for posterity.

Monochrome in channel mixer, levels, and unsharp mask.
